Health Minister Ahmed Naseem has said that a booster shot for the Coronavirus vaccine may be necessary for the future.

Under their " Last One Mile Support " program, the Japanese Government had handed over 112,000 doses of the AstraZeneca Vaccine today.

Speaking to the press after receiving the vaccine, Minister Naseem said that this was a really good program and that the vaccine doses will come in handy in the future when a booster shot is administered.

However, the Minister did not give any further details regarding the administration of the booster shot.

While the Health Minister has mentioned the booster shot, the Food & Drug Authority (FDA) in the USA has approved booster shots for those with compromised immune systems. The USA is expected to administer booster shots for Moderna and Pfizer.
